Having grown up in a big boxing town in Pennsylvania, fought himself for seventeen years and now trained other fighters since 1992, you can only say that Xavier Biggs, the owner of the Decatur Boxing Club, is a world class trainer with impeccable credentials. With plans to make Atlanta a great fight city like his hometown of Philadelphia and a strong desire to help his boxers get in shape physically, mentally and spiritually, Biggs opened the training club in Decatur three years ago.

The key ingredient Biggs hopes to see in the boxers he trains is dedication. While he generally prefers to have a period of six weeks to get his boxers ready for a fight, he can get someone ready in a week if the person makes the right commitment. The facility, not a glamorized environment and not intended to be a conventional fitness club, is a venue for serious training. It is “the realness” and that “gritty feeling of the gym” that Biggs loves and one which he believes makes the gym a great place for boxers, men or women, to train.

One of his fighters, Terri Moss, excelled to the point of becoming the WIBF Strawweight title, which she still holds. Moss’s success enabled her to leave her 13-year career in law enforcement.

For each boxer he trains, he helps them to set goals for themselves and expects them to seek to meet them. He wants them to be strong, quick, alert and coordinated while in the ring. As for the spirit of the gym, there are no stereotypes. There are specific time periods where they conduct a female boxing program and all men must leave. According to Biggs, whose brother, Tyrell, fought with Mike Tyson in 1984, “My biggest reward from my experience in boxing is being able to use my skills and knowledge to help the average person better themselves. Whether it’s a fighter preparing for a world title or an executive on a personal mission, my desire is to see that person at their best using all my resources to obtain those goals.”
